BBA204: Industry Policy and Business Management |
This unit introduces the microeconomic policy environment within which business operates. It covers competition policy, tariff policy, tax policy, foreign investment policy, and research and development policy. The unit also covers further topics in applied business economics, including business pricing strategies, the economics of information, cost/benefit analysis and the debate concerning regulation/deregulation/privatisation.
